Meaning & usage

name/mɪŋ/
  1. A former dynasty in China, reigning from the end of the Yuan to the beginning of the Qing (Ching).

  2. A former empire in China, occupying the eastern half of modern China (China proper), as well as parts of Russia and northern Vietnam

  3. The era of Chinese history during which the dynasty reigned

  4. A surname.

  5. A male or female given name.

Where this word comes from

From Mandarin 明 (Míng).

noun/mɪŋ/
  1. A member of the Ming dynasty.

    countable
  2. The pottery of the Ming era, famed for its high quality.

    uncountable
Where this word comes from

From Mandarin 明 (Míng).
